WebABSTRACT. Sexual reproduction in euglenoid flagellates is poorly known. Interestingly, Euglena is the only known microorganism whose chloroplasts are easy to … WebEuglena employ a simple and primal method of reproduction, known as Binary Fission. Reproduction by binary fission involves an organism merely splitting (= fission) into two (= binary) identical halves.
